The Pfizer vaccine is set to be administered to residents and staff of Sterling Place, a senior living community associated with Holiday Retirement, at 9:30 a.m. on Monday, January 4 and Monday, January 25 at the facility, located at 22800 Civic Center Drive in Southfield.
The vaccine is optional for Sterling Place residents and staff; but, only residents and staff can receive the vaccine at this clinic.
Residents and staff can sign up in advance to get the vaccine if desired.

Among the first in the nation to receive the vaccine, the on-site clinic is being done through Oakland County Health Department, with the first dose being given on January 4 and the second on January 25.

Royal Oak night shelter opens and seeks more volunteers
Rotating shelter will run through Feb. 28

ROYAL OAK Public and private entities throughout Oakland County have been working together to solve the problem of providing a winter night shelter to the homeless population during a global pandemic. The rotating night shelter program, established in 1993, initially was canceled this year due to COVID-19.

Over the next few weeks, Oakland County public health nurses are planning to administer upwards of 1,800 doses of the Pfizer COVID-19 vaccine to first responders.Â
The county has not received its initial allocation. Tuesday morning, Pfizer representatives informed the county to expect its initial shipment of 1,950 doses either late this week or early next week. The health division expects to receive its second round of doses sometime after the first of the year. The Pfizer vaccine is being manufactured in and shipped across the country to hospitals and local health departments from the company s manufacturing plant in Portage, Mich.Â
The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) granted the Pfizer vaccine emergency use authorization (EUA) last Friday with Michigan hospitals including Spectrum Health in Grand Rapids, Michigan Medicine in Ann Arbor and Beaumont Health in Southfield administering the state s first doses on Monday and Tuesday to groups of frontline health workers.
